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 chicken breasts (thawed and trimmed)
  • 1 ounce taco seasoning
  • 1 ounce ranch seasoning mix
  • 15 ounces canned black beans (undrained)
  • 15 ounces canned corn (undrained)
  • 10 ounces canned Rotel tomatoes with green chiles (undrained)
  • 8 ounces cream cheese

Instructions

  1. Prepare your Crock Pot by placing the chicken breasts at the bottom.
  2. Sprinkle taco and ranch seasonings over the chicken. Add undrained black beans, corn, and Rotel tomatoes on top.
  3. Place cream cheese on top of all ingredients.
  4. Cook on LOW for 6-8 hours or HIGH for 3-4 hours until chicken is tender.
  5. Shred the chicken in the pot, stir to combine, and serve hot.
